ASUS Dual GeForce RTX 2080 SUPER OC Evo V2
vs
MSI GeForce RTX 2060 AERO ITX 6G


GPU comparison with benchmarks

The ASUS Dual GeForce RTX 2080 SUPER OC Evo V2 is based on the NVIDIA GeForce RTX 2080 SUPER (Turing) and has 8 GB GDDR6 graphics memory with a bandwidth of 496 GB/s.

The MSI GeForce RTX 2060 AERO ITX 6G is based on the NVIDIA GeForce RTX 2060 (Turing) and has 6 GB GDDR6 graphics memory with a bandwidth of 336 GB/s.

GPU

The ASUS Dual GeForce RTX 2080 SUPER OC Evo V2 has the TU104 graphics chip installed, which is based on the Turing architecture.

The MSI GeForce RTX 2060 AERO ITX 6G is based on the graphics chip TU106, which comes from the Turing architecture.

Memory

The graphics memory of the ASUS Dual GeForce RTX 2080 SUPER OC Evo V2 clocks at 1.938 GHz, which corresponds to a speed of 15.5 Gbps.

The graphics memory speed of the MSI GeForce RTX 2060 AERO ITX 6G is 14.0 Gbps and the clock speed is 1.750 GHz.

Thermal Design

The ASUS Dual GeForce RTX 2080 SUPER OC Evo V2 is powered by 2 x 8-Pin connectors. The TDP (Thermal Design Power) of the graphics card is 250 W.

The MSI GeForce RTX 2060 AERO ITX 6G has 1 x 8-Pin PCIe power connectors that supply it with energy. The manufacturer specifies the TDP of the card as 160 W.

Dimensions

The ASUS Dual GeForce RTX 2080 SUPER OC Evo V2 is connected to the system via PCIe 3.0 x 16 lanes and requires 3 PCIe-Slots space in the housing.

The MSI GeForce RTX 2060 AERO ITX 6G needs the space of 2 PCIe-Slots in the case and has a PCIe 3.0 x 16 Lanes interface.
